Frame Requirements for BMX Tricks and Stunts
When performing BMX tricks and stunts, the frame not only supports the body and bike but also plays a central role in the execution of the moves. The right frames for BMX bikes provide stability and agility during takeoffs, landings, and continuous maneuvers. Factors such as frame geometry, chainstay length, and head tube angle directly impact the precision and safety of maneuvers. Choosing the right BMX bike frames ensures smooth and natural tailwhips, barspins, and nose maneuvers.
The Importance of Stability and Durability
Stability and durability are fundamental to trick BMX frames. High-strength chromoly frames or steel BMX bike frames can withstand the stresses of jumps, hard landings, and continuous combos. Reinforced welds and downtubes are crucial to prevent cracking or bending under high impact. Frames that can withstand “bomb drops” are considered heavy-duty trick frames and are the preferred choice for street and skate park riding.

The Impact of Material Selection on Performance
Frame material determines the suitability of BMX frames for trick riding. Steel and chromoly frames are strong and suitable for hard landings and continuous jumps. Aluminum frames are lightweight but less impact-resistant, making them better suited for smaller park and street tricks. Carbon BMX frames offer a balance of weight and stiffness, making them ideal for high-speed, fluid maneuvers. Professional riders call them “race-ready trick frames,” as they maintain precise control even during high-intensity maneuvers.

Choosing Frames for BMX Bikes Based on Your Riding Style
Different riding environments require different frames:
- Street: Short chainstays and a flexible top tube design are essential for manuals, grinds, and tailwhips.
- Dirt/Jumps: Impact resistance and stability are paramount, so a strong chromoly frame is ideal.
- Skatepark: A balance of lightness and maneuverability is essential for combos and aerials.
Industry jargon refers to street bike frames as “tech frames,” jump bikes as “jump setups,” and skatepark frames as “park rigs,” each with its own distinct focus.
The Importance of Size and Geometry
A BMX bike frame’s top tube length, seat tube height, head tube angle, and chainstay length directly impact performance:
- A short top tube improves agility during turns and rotations
- A steep head tube angle enhances front-end responsiveness
- A long chainstay increases stability, making it ideal for jumps and high-speed landings
A well-designed geometry ensures precise tailwhips, barspins, and nose maneuvers, minimizing force deviation and landing risk.

Routinely Inspecting Key Areas of BMX Frames
Regularly inspecting the weld joints, downtube, rear triangle, and load-bearing interfaces is crucial. Jumps, drop-ins, and continuous combos create high stress points in these areas. Professional riders often refer to potential cracking areas as “weak spots.” If cracks or bends are detected, the frame should be removed from service and repaired immediately to avoid accidents.
Cleaning and Lubrication Recommendations
Keeping BMX frames and their connections clean can reduce corrosion and wear. Use mild detergent and a soft brush to clean the frame, avoiding direct impact with high-pressure water jets on welds and bearings. Critical joints like the chain, seatpost, and hubs should be regularly lubricated with high-performance grease, commonly known in the industry as “carbon TLC” or “frame lube,” to effectively prevent slippage and binding.

Frequently Asked Questions
What is the best frame material for BMX tricks?
Chromoly steel remains the gold standard for trick riding due to its exceptional strength-to-weight ratio and ability to absorb impacts from hard landings. For riders seeking maximum weight savings without sacrificing durability, modern carbon fiber frames offer excellent performance, particularly for park and competition riding.
How does chainstay length affect BMX trick performance?
Shorter chainstays (typically 12.5″ to 13.25″) make the bike more responsive and easier to spin, whip, and maneuver during technical tricks. Longer chainstays (13.5″ and above) provide greater stability at speed and during landings, making them better suited for dirt jumping and transition riding.
What head tube angle is best for BMX street riding?
A head tube angle between 75° and 76° is generally ideal for street riding. This steeper angle provides quicker steering response and better front-end control for nose manuals, hang-5s, and other technical maneuvers that require precise front wheel placement.
How often should I inspect my BMX frame for damage?
Inspect your BMX frame before every riding session, focusing on weld joints, the downtube, and the rear triangle. After particularly hard sessions involving large jumps or heavy landings, perform a thorough inspection looking for hairline cracks, dents, or bent tubes. Replace the frame immediately if any structural damage is detected.
Can I use a carbon BMX frame for street riding?
While carbon BMX frames offer excellent stiffness and weight savings, they are generally better suited for park and racing applications. Street riding involves frequent contact with concrete and rails, which can damage carbon frames more easily than chromoly steel. If you ride primarily street, a chromoly frame is typically the more durable and practical choice.
